Hidden Household Pests



Are you familiar with the hidden house bugs that may be hiding in your home? While you may be vigilant concerning common parasites like ants or crawlers, there are various other stealthy intruders that could be triggering harm behind the scenes.



One such insect is the silverfish, a tiny bug that grows in moist and dark environments like cellars and bathrooms. These pests can damage books, clothes, and even wallpaper, making them an annoyance to deal with.

Another hidden insect to keep an eye out for is the rug beetle. These small pests prey on a variety of products found in homes, such as rugs, clothing, and furniture. Their larvae can cause considerable damages if left unchecked, making it vital to address any type of signs of problem immediately.

Additionally, mold mites are frequently ignored but can show a wetness issue in your house. These tiny creatures feed upon mold and can intensify allergic reactions for delicate people. Keeping your home completely dry and well-ventilated can assist stop these parasites from taking up residence in your home.

Unwelcome Intruders



Unwanted trespassers can interrupt your family peace and cause damages if not managed immediately. While insects like rodents and roaches are generally understood, various other lesser-known burglars like silverfish and carpeting beetles can also create chaos in your home. Silverfish are little, wingless bugs that flourish in wet locations and prey on starchy products like paper and adhesive, triggering damages to books, wallpaper, and clothing. Carpeting beetles, on the other hand, feast on a selection of items such as carpetings, apparel, and upholstery, causing expensive damage if left unattended.

These unwanted trespassers not just damage your valuables yet can likewise posture health risks. Rodents and cockroaches, as an example, can spread conditions via their droppings and pee, contaminating surface areas and food. Silverfish and carpeting beetles can cause allergies in some individuals, bring about skin inflammation and respiratory system problems.

To prevent these burglars from taking over your home, it's vital to maintain cleanliness, seal entrance points, and quickly deal with any indicators of problem. 1. ** Silverfish **: These small, silvery pests enjoy damp, dark rooms like basements and bathrooms. They eat starchy materials and can trigger damage to books, wallpaper, and clothing.

2. ** Carpeting Beetles **: Frequently incorrect for harmless ladybugs, carpet beetles can wreak havoc on your home. Their larvae eat natural fibers like woollen and silk, creating irreparable damage to carpets, clothes, and furniture.

3. ** Earwigs **: In spite of their ominous-looking pincers, earwigs are more of a hassle than a danger. They're attracted to dampness and can find their means into your home via fractures and holes. Keep an eye out for them in wet locations like bathroom and kitchens.
